[llvm] r200461 - Remove duplicate patterns
Craig Topper
craig.topper at gmail.com
Wed Jan 29 23:19:10 PST 2014
Author: ctopper
Date: Thu Jan 30 01:19:10 2014
New Revision: 200461
URL: http://llvm.org/viewvc/llvm-project?rev=200461&view=rev
Log:
Remove duplicate patterns
Modified:
llvm/trunk/lib/Target/X86/X86InstrSSE.td
Modified: llvm/trunk/lib/Target/X86/X86InstrSSE.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/X86/X86InstrSSE.td?rev=200461&r1=200460&r2=200461&view=diff
==============================================================================
--- llvm/trunk/lib/Target/X86/X86InstrSSE.td (original)
+++ llvm/trunk/lib/Target/X86/X86InstrSSE.td Thu Jan 30 01:19:10 2014
@@ -3695,11 +3695,6 @@ def MOVNTI_64mr : RI<0xC3, MRMDestMem, (
TB, Requires<[HasSSE2]>;
} // SchedRW = [WriteStore]
-def : Pat<(alignednontemporalstore (v2i64 VR128:$src), addr:$dst),
- (VMOVNTDQmr addr:$dst, VR128:$src)>, Requires<[HasAVX]>;
-
-def : Pat<(alignednontemporalstore (v2i64 VR128:$src), addr:$dst),
- (MOVNTDQmr addr:$dst, VR128:$src)>, Requires<[UseSSE2]>;
} // AddedComplexity
//===----------------------------------------------------------------------===//
More information about the llvm-commits
mailing list